They’re situated off of your shore—hence the time period, “offshore.” This normally means Eastern Europe, Asia, or Latin America. At the most affordable pricing, we additionally assure one of the best https://slurpystudios.com/storyboarding-charity-davss-the-monster/ of the providers by means of high quality. You can examine more about Our Pricing, Client Testimonials or just Contact Us right here. Establish clear expectations and objectives upfront to ensure alignment and avoid misunderstandings. Consider cultural match by engaging in open conversations about work values and collaboration.
The Hybrid Model: Can You Utilize Both?
Even in case your project wasn’t all that outlined initially, these instructions will build the concrete foundation upon which offshore developers can work and bring valuable results to the table. The clearer the image you could have of your vision, the sooner your project will come out of the wireframing and sketching stage. The offshore approach can revolutionize your business if you’re struggling with talent shortages or striving to outpace competitors. When you’ve laid the foundation, the next step is to pick your offshore companion fastidiously. Look for destinations recognized for their sturdy IT data and favorable enterprise conditions, corresponding to India, Ukraine, or Poland.
Why Do Firms Outsource Recruitment For Tech Expertise
This associate will assist in finding and recruiting expert developers, making certain legal and regulatory compliance, and dealing with administrative and supervisory duties. Over the years, we’ve found that establishing clear growth goals and maintaining honest communication is crucial to harnessing the total potential of offshore software improvement. That’s why we suggest conducting a Discovery Phase to grasp your unique enterprise goals, decide your finances, and establish the number of builders needed to attain your aims.
Step 9: Select Location Strategically For Project Resilience
For occasion, we display CVs within 24 hours, organize interviews within three days, and handle negotiating and contract signing within 1-2 weeks, making certain a clean and swift hiring process. Onboarding and integration take just 1-3 days, allowing you to scale your development team up or down quickly to satisfy fluctuating workloads or changing project necessities. This lets you optimize your growth costs and useful resource allocation all through the project lifecycle.
Real-life Examples Of Onshore Software Program Growth
Nearshore growth prices more, with rates starting from $40 to $150 per hour or much more, while onshore growth is the most expensive, with rates ranging from $75 to $250 per hour. Offshore software improvement can help you enhance your time to market by allowing you to scale your team up or down as wanted. This is particularly useful for startups and small companies that may not have the assets to rent a large in-house team. Offshore software program development usually entails sharing delicate data and intellectual property with external teams. Ensuring that the offshore associate has robust security measures in place and complies with information protection rules is essential to mitigate these risks.
Instead, they’ll depend on an skilled improvement group to deal with the app creation while they remain focused on their major enterprise wants and day-to-day operations. This method permits for a more environment friendly use of assets and ensures that non-IT companies can nonetheless benefit from cutting-edge know-how with out detracting from their core competencies. Offshore software program improvement is the practice of hiring exterior software improvement companies situated in other international locations to complete particular tasks or projects. Offshore outsourcing firms positioned in countries with lower labor prices and provide providers to shoppers around the world. Generally, businesses use outsourcing services to keep away from wasting time and money or to obtain abilities that the in-house group lacks. Offshore software program growth has turn into an more and more in style apply among companies seeking to scale back improvement prices and improve their competitive edge.
App growth value per hour can vary significantly based mostly on the placement of your offshoring associate. By partnering with international locations in Central Europe, similar to Estonia, Croatia, Albania, or Portugal, it can save you 50% or more on development costs. Enter the offshore developers staff, strategically stationed in regions with lower labor prices. This group handles technical heavy lifting such as coding, testing, and backend growth. By tapping into a worldwide talent pool, the offshore team significantly bolsters development capability whereas optimizing prices.
With the right outsourcing software program growth firm by your side, the possibilities are endless. No longer do companies need to rent employees at their doorstep to finish a variety of services. Today, they can discover talent in a variety of locations — even ones outdoors of their nation.
A lot of organizations prefer to rent freelancers or contractors on an as-needed foundation rather than long-term outsourcing agreements. On-demand options provide larger flexibility, project sustainability, and cost financial savings for short-term initiatives. The first step of any software program growth project is putting collectively an in depth listing of requirements. This data is used to plan the work scope and outline the character of the product.
A communication infrastructure that supports real-time communication, collaboration, and task tracking can reduce miscommunications and help ensure the project stays on monitor. Investing in a communication infrastructure may improve upfront prices but can ultimately decrease the overall software program growth price and well timed completion. Onshore software program development offers higher danger administration since companies can control the event course of more. Offshore growth carries a higher danger of miscommunication and cultural variations, which can influence the development course of.
Meaning that even with nice project ideas, most firms can’t deliver them to life with their current in-house development team. Who knows how many great products the world missed out on because of this talent scarcity? Thankfully, not all nice ideas are doomed, as Internet access and globalization gave us offshoring software growth with all its execs and cons. Choosing the best offshore software program development companion is essential for the success of any project. However, selecting the right offshore improvement partner requires cautious consideration of several elements.
- Offshore software program growth triumphs over onshore software program improvement because of considerably low development costs.
- Software development offshoring could be a tough business, and you never know how many developers you may need at any time during the project.
- It’s vital to ascertain clear security protocols, use secure communication channels, conduct safety audits, and just build sincere communication to have the ability to guarantee your delicate knowledge safety.
- Offshoring usually means a quantity of time zones separate the shopper and vendor’s areas.
- When you’ve laid the foundation, the subsequent step is to decide out your offshore partner rigorously.
Establishing trust, fostering a team tradition of accountability, and embracing emerging developments and technologies can also contribute to project success. Although offshore software improvement could be cost-effective, this doesn’t imply that the quality of the development work shall be compromised. In many cases, offshore builders have in depth experience and knowledge in their areas of expertise. Additionally, many offshore improvement firms have strict high quality management processes in place to ensure that their work meets the best requirements. Finding expert tech professionals regionally can be tough, no because of the continuing global IT expertise shortage.
Before disclosing details of your project to the seller, clarify the info practices and safety protocols they use. If they meet the requirements, sign a non-disclosure settlement (NDA) with the company, which specifies classes of confidential knowledge and penalties for violating the NDA. Additionally, software engineers and different specialists may fit with a quantity of purchasers and tasks simultaneously, not giving their full attention to your wants and, thus, delivering poor results. In some cases, they are close in that means because offshoring is one kind of outsourcing that’s decided by geography. Whether outsourcing is considered offshoring is dependent upon your location and the vendor’s location. We’ll clarify why folks confuse the terms shortly, however fundamentally, it’s incorrect to say that offshoring and outsourcing are the identical.